Gernie Ford 1900 - 1975

Gernie Ford of Roundhead, Hardin County, Ohio was born on December 4, 1900, and died at age 74 years old in July 1975.

In 1931, at the age of 31 years old, Gernie was alive when in March, “The Star Spangled Banner” officially became the national anthem by congressional resolution. Other songs had previously been used - among them, "My Country, 'Tis of Thee", "God Bless America", and "America the Beautiful". There was fierce debate about making "The Star Spangled Banner" the national anthem - Southerners and veterans organizations supported it, pacifists and educators opposed it.
